    • @ZeroTo60Tube
      @ZeroTo60Tube  10 месяцев назад +1

      So pure race application with no torque reduction (anything using a clutch pedal) the 8hp45 we broke one at 500whp in about 2 mins. The 70s seem much much stronger. Now you add some torque reduction to the mix and the 8hp45 will hold a lot more. But you loose a lot of the agression with torque reduction on.@@Twittenberg

    • @ZeroTo60Tube
      @ZeroTo60Tube  9 месяцев назад

      I dont think its a torque management issue....... But many other issues with the product/software. I've spoken to many with damaged DCTs whos engines dont make enough power to hurth the DCT clutches. Then all the 8hp70 failures as well, which will take an absolute spanking with out torque management.

    Seeing how brake input disengages the clutch there isn’t brake boosting in a DCT ?

    • @ZeroTo60Tube
      @ZeroTo60Tube  9 месяцев назад +1

      You can brake boost. There are a few conditions that have to be met for it to open the clutches. If you are accelerating and braking it will keep the clutches engaged. Even if braking while decelerating and with keep them engaged for engine braking. However depends on how much torque the engine making
